Welcome to the DatoCMS Blog

News, tips and highlights from the team at DatoCMS
Latest from our Product Updates changelog →
Enhancements to Structured Text
October 31st, 2024
Translator roles can now create new records!
Translators can now not only edit existing records, but also to create new records by themselves!
How to Use DatoCMS's Structured Text Field in a NextJS App
In early 2021 Dato launched a revolutionary new feature that greatly enhances the experience of editors who use the CMS to enter and manage content. In this post, we're going to walk through all you need to know as a developer to start using Structured Text in your website.
Next.js SEO DatoCMS
Dealing with SEO in Next.js
Let’s learn about SEO, how to address it in Next.js, and why adopting a headless CMS solution might be the best approach.
October Update - Nested blocks, Gatsby v4... and new plugin system!
Nested blocks are out at last, roles inheritance will make your life easier, new plugin system is in the works... and a lot more!
What You Should Know about the Next.js Image component
All you need to know about Next.js built-in image component, one of the best perks of Next.js > 10
The wait is over: Nested Blocks are here!
The most requested feature in the history of DatoCMS is finally ready. You can now expand the possibilities of your content model by nesting multiple levels of blocks!
Introducing Inherited Roles, for greater modularity in role management
Using inherited roles, you can easily create role hierarchies which mirror real-world operational or organizational hierarchies, without having to duplicate permissions assignments for multiple different roles.
Ecommerce Next.js tutorial
How To Build an Ecommerce with Next.js and Snipcart
Being able to build an ecommerce application from scratch is now more valuable than ever. Thankfully, several libraries have been released to help developers achieve this goal with less effort. So, let’s see how to develop an ecommerce website in JavaScript and Next.js using Snipcart.
September Update: Security, Performance... and a teaser!
Despite the summer holidays, a lot has been achieved in DatoCMS-land! Learn about the latest improvements, optimizations and activities of our team.
Next.js i18n
How To Build a Multi-Language Website with Next.js i18n
How to build an international multi-language website in JavaScript and Next.js from scratch.
What happened in the last few months and plans for Q4 21
Let's review together the latest developments on DatoCMS and see what the future will bring to the table
Headless CMS multisite - Omnichannel
Headless CMS as a Winning Strategy for Multi-Site Management
What is the Multi-site management problem and why a headless CMS is the solution.
Even more control for your sensitive projects: introducing Audit Logs
Today, we're happy to publicly release another vital feature for our Enterprise customers and fast growing startups: Audit Logs.
Stepping up the content localization game: introducing Translator roles
Today we're thrilled to release Translator roles, a way to restrict your translators to edit only the locales they are responsible for. Is it the missing puzzle piece that allows DatoCMS to be a complete solution for every localization need.
An (even more) open company
From today we want to be more transparent and less "shy" in telling our story. Find out why.
Start using DatoCMS today
According to Gartner 89% of companies plan to compete primarily on the basis of customer experience this year. Don't get caught unprepared.
  • No credit card
  • Easy setup
Subscribe to our newsletter! 📥
One update per month. All the latest news and sneak peeks directly in your inbox.
support@datocms.com ©2024 Dato srl, all rights reserved P.IVA 06969620480